Definition
- 1etwas, das für eine bestimmte Gruppe von Personen verbindlich ist
- 2ein Schriftstück, auf das sich interessierte Kreise durch Mitarbeit in einem Normenausschuss geeinigt haben, das Empfehlungscharakter besitzt und das durch ein Gesetz, eine Verordnung oder einen Vertrag verbindlich gemacht werden kann
- 3Eigenschaft, die den Erwartungen entspricht
- 4Mindestleistung im Arbeitsleben oder im Sport
- 5Festlegung für die Qualität von Produkten, für Produktionsverfahren oder die Anwendung von Begriffen oder Termini
